evansb is right

SNCASO ONERA Deltaviex (VX)


strange plane, my French isn't perfect but from what I could understand it had a high-sweep wing (but not a delta, despite the name), blown flaps and no directional controls, or, to be more precise, directional control was obtained by some kind of air blowing (unsure if directional nozzles or some sort of Coanda effect)...
Now at Ailes Anciennes Toulouse (Ailes Anciennes Toulouse - Découvrez notre Collection).
